2025年中职第二学年(计算机应用)数据库应用基础试题及答案_第1页
2025年中职第二学年(计算机应用)数据库应用基础试题及答案_第2页
2025年中职第二学年(计算机应用)数据库应用基础试题及答案_第3页
2025年中职第二学年(计算机应用)数据库应用基础试题及答案_第4页
2025年中职第二学年(计算机应用)数据库应用基础试题及答案_第5页
已阅读5页,还剩2页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

2025年中职第二学年(计算机应用)数据库应用基础试题及答案

(考试时间:90分钟满分100分)班级______姓名______第I卷(选择题,共40分)答题要求:每题只有一个正确答案,请将正确答案的序号填在括号内。(总共20题,每题2分)1.数据库系统的核心是()A.数据库B.数据库管理系统C.数据模型D.软件工具2.数据库管理系统能实现对数据库中数据的查询、插入、修改和删除等操作,这种功能称为()A.数据定义功能B.数据管理功能C.数据操纵功能D.数据控制功能3.下列关于数据库特点的说法中正确的是()A.数据能共享且独立性高B.数据能共享但数据冗余很高C.能保证数据完整性但降低了安全性D.数据独立性高但不能实现共享4.数据库系统的数据独立性是指()A.不会因为数据的变化而影响应用程序B.不会因为系统数据存储结构与数据逻辑结构的变化而影响应用程序C.不会因为存储策略的变化而影响存储结构D.不会因为某些存储结构的变化而影响其他的存储结构5.数据库设计中,用E-R图来描述信息结构但不涉及信息在计算机中的表示,它属于数据库设计的()阶段。A.需求分析B.概念设计C.逻辑设计D.物理设计6.关系数据库管理系统应能实现的专门关系运算包括()A.排序、索引、统计B.选择、投影、连接C.关联、更新、排序D.显示、打印、制表7.在关系数据库中,用来表示实体之间联系的是()A.树结构B.网结构C.线性表D.二维表8.若实体A和B是多对多的联系,实体B和C是1对1的联系,则实体A和C是()联系。A.1对1B.1对多C.多对1D.多对多9.一个关系数据库文件中的各条记录()A.前后顺序不能任意颠倒,一定要按照输入的顺序排列B.前后顺序可以任意颠倒,不影响库中的数据关系C.前后顺序可以任意颠倒,但排列顺序不同,统计处理的结果就可能不同D.前后顺序不能任意颠倒,一定要按照关键字段值的顺序排列10.关系模型中,一个关键字是()A.可由多个任意属性组成B.至多由一个属性组成C.可由一个或多个其值能唯一标识该关系模式中任何元组的属性组成D.以上都不是11.在SQL语言中,用于修改表结构的语句是()A.ALTERB.CREATEC.UPDATED.DELETE12.在SQL语言中,删除表中数据的语句是()A.DELETEB.DROPC.CLEARD.REMOVE13.要查询学生表中的所有记录,SQL语句应为()A.SELECTFROM学生表B.SELECT学生表C.SELECTALLFROM学生表D.SELECTFROM学生表14.若要查询学生表中年龄大于20岁的学生姓名,SQL语句应为()A.SELECT姓名FROM学生表WHERE年龄>20B.SELECT年龄>2WHERE姓名FROM学生表C.SELECT姓名WHERE年龄>20FROM学生表D.SELECT年龄>20FROM学生表WHERE姓名15.要向学生表中插入一条新记录,SQL语句应为()A.INSERTINTO学生表VALUES(值1,值2,…)B.INSERTVALUES(值1,值2,…)INTO学生表C.INSERTINTO学生表SET值1,值2,…)D.INSERTVALUES(值1,值2,…)SET学生表16.数据库管理系统的英文缩写是()A.DBB.DBSC.DBMSD.DBA17.数据库系统是由()组成的。A.数据库、数据库管理系统和用户B.数据文件、命令文件和报表C.数据库文件结构和数据D.常量、变量和函数18.数据库设计的需求分析阶段主要设计()A.程序流程图B.数据流程图C.模块结构图D.功能结构图19.关系数据库中的表不必具有的性质是()A.数据项不可再分B.同一列数据项要具有相同的数据类型C.记录的顺序可以任意排列D.字段的顺序不能任意排列20.若要查询学生表中姓“李”的学生信息,SQL语句应为()A.SELECTFROM学生表WHERE姓名LIKE'李%'B.SELECTFROM学生表WHERE姓名='李%'C.SELECTFROM学生表WHERE姓名LIKE'%李'D.SELECTFROM学生表WHERE姓名='%李'第II卷(非选择题,共60分)21.填空题:(总共10空,每空2分)(1)数据库系统一般由数据库、数据库管理系统、应用系统、()和用户构成。(2)数据模型通常由数据结构、数据操作和()三部分组成。(3)关系代数的运算可分为传统的集合运算和专门的关系运算,传统的集合运算包括并、差、交、()。(4)在SQL语言中,用于创建表的语句是()。(5)在关系数据库中,实体之间的联系是通过()来实现的。(6)数据库设计的步骤包括需求分析、概念结构设计、逻辑结构设计、物理结构设计、数据库实施、()。(7)在SQL查询中,使用()子句可以对查询结果进行分组。(8)若要查询学生表中成绩最高的学生信息,可使用()函数。(9)在关系模型中,二维表的每一行称为一个()。(10)在SQL语言中,用于删除表的语句是()。22.简答题:(总共3题,每题10分)(1)简述数据库管理系统的主要功能。(2)简述数据库设计的基本步骤。(3)简述关系模型的特点。23.操作题:(总共1题,20分)已知有学生表(学号,姓名,性别,年龄,专业),课程表(课程号,课程名,学分),选课表(学号,课程号,成绩)。请写出SQL语句:(1)查询所有学生的姓名、专业。(2)查询选修了课程号为“C01”课程的学生学号和成绩。(3)查询年龄大于20岁的学生姓名和专业。24.材料分析题:(总共1题,10分)材料:某学校为了更好地管理学生信息,决定建立一个数据库系统。在需求分析阶段,收集到了学生的基本信息(如学号、姓名、性别、年龄、专业等)、课程信息(如课程号、课程名、学分等)以及学生选课信息(如学号、课程号、成绩等)。问题:请根据上述材料,设计该数据库系统的E-R图。25.综合应用题:(总共1题,10分)假设你要为一个小型书店设计一个数据库系统,用于管理图书信息、客户信息和销售信息。图书信息包括书号、书名、作者、出版社、出版日期、价格等;客户信息包括客户编号、姓名、性别、联系方式等;销售信息包括销售单号、客户编号、书号、销售数量、销售日期等。请设计该数据库系统涉及的表结构,并写出查询销售数量大于5的图书信息

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论